What is a summary of the preamble

History
1 answer:
topjm [15]3 years ago
3 0
<span>The Preamble is the opening statement to the United States Constitution. The preamble explains the reasons why the Framers of the Constitution made our government a republic. By doing this, the founding fathers replaced the Articles of Confederation.</span>

Why was the War 1812 unnecessary?​
Reil [10]

Answer:

The American Revolution was, of course, fought between America and Great Britain. The second war between America and Great Britain was the War of 1812.  Some historians feel that this was an unnecessary war and that the conflicts between the two countries could have been solved peacefully if both sides had communicated more effectively.

Tension had been building up between Great Britain and the United States for several years. The tension was about how the British treated American sailors, how the British were befriending Native Americans, and also about trade policies and taxes. When the war ended in December of 1814, the military fighting stopped, but none of the issues that started the war had been resolved.
